DataGrip is a cross-platform integrated development environment (IDE) that supports multiple database environments. The most important thing to note about DataGrip is that it's developed by JetBrains, one of the leading brands for developing IDEs. If you have ever used PhpStorm, IntelliJ IDEA, PyCharm, WebStorm, you won't need an introduction on how good JetBrains IDEs are. - Source: dev.to / over 5 years ago

For testing third-party API calls, you can use libraries such as WireMock or Nock. These tools allow you to simulate HTTP requests and responses, helping you test how your application behaves when interacting with an external service. For example, you can mock successful responses, simulate errors, or test timeouts, all without making real HTTP requests. - Source: dev.to / almost 2 years ago
WireMock is a versatile, open-source platform for API mocking, offering powerful simulation features for both HTTP and HTTPS protocols. It’s highly customizable and is especially well-suited for complex use cases, such as testing microservices architectures and handling advanced behaviors. - Source: dev.to / almost 2 years ago
